1 recall across 1 model year
The Honda CB500FA has 1 recall affecting the 2013 model year, where rocker arm shaft retaining bolts can loosen during engine operation, first causing a slow oil leak and eventually falling out of the cylinder head entirely, which can cause the engine to lose power and stall. A stall in traffic raises the risk of a crash. The recall covers 2013 CB500 and CBR500 variants, so owners of any of those related models are affected by the same defect.
